Five-year-old child dies after electrocution

Police at Kabalagala Police Division are investigating a tragic incident in which a five-year-old girl died after being electrocuted in Kakunguru Zone, Kibuli, Makindye Division, Kampala.

The deceased has been identified as Ayomirwoth Rehema. The incident occurred on Wednesday, January 28, 2026, at about 11:00 a.m. It is alleged that the child was playing with other children near a drainage channel when she came into contact with a live stay wire supporting an electric pole, resulting in fatal electrocution.

Police officers, together with Scenes of Crime Officers (SOCOs), promptly responded to the scene. The area was examined and documented, after which the body was conveyed to Mulago City Mortuary for a postmortem examination.

Officials from the electricity distribution company were notified and disconnected the affected wire to prevent further danger to the public.

“No arrests have been made so far, and inquiries into the incident are ongoing,” said ASP Luke Owoyesigyire, Deputy Public Relations Officer, Kampala Metropolitan Police.

He added: “Police urge members of the public to promptly report exposed or faulty electrical installations to the relevant authorities in order to prevent similar incidents.”
